Depending on where you're coming from, your flight to Mussey could be simple and straightforward or it could go on forever. Below are some useful tips that will help you start your next big adventure on a positive note. What to pack in your hand luggage:
- A plane trip can be a great experience if you carry the right things. First things first, you'll need basic toiletry items, such as lip balm and hand cream, a spare set of clothes and a good book. Next, find a spot in your hand luggage for your mobile phone, a charger, any vital medications and maybe a blow-up neck pillow as well. Lastly, don't forget to bring your passport, travel documents and some cash.
Do not pack the following items in your hand luggage:
- While the list of banned items can differ between air carriers, the general rule of thumb is nothing sharp, flammable or explosive. This includes things like screwdrivers, drills, fireworks and fuel. Sporting equipment like ice skates, and items that could harm passengers, such as swords and batons, are also banned from the cabin.
What to wear on a flight:
- Your main aim is to be as comfortable as you can. Go for a pair of flat, closed-toe shoes, dress in loose, natural-fiber clothing and don't forget to take a sweater in case you get chilly in the cabin.
- Caused by prolonged periods of inactivity, deep vein thrombosis (DVT) is a blood clotting condition that can affect passengers on long-distance flights. Lower your risks by drinking water, keeping your legs moving and wearing compression tights or socks.
